#62342e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#62342e is composed of 38.4% red, 20.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.9% magenta, 53.1%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 6.9 degrees, a saturation of 36.1% and a lightness of 28.2%. #62342e color hex could be obtained by blending #c4685c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#62342e color description : Very dark desaturated red.

#62342e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#62342e has RGB values of R:98, G:52,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.53,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6435886.

Shades and Tints of #62342e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050202 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f6 is the lightest one.
